Разделитель CDC
Разделитель CDC разбивает один поток строк изменений из потока исходных данных CDC на различные потоки данных, относящиеся к операциям Insert, Update и Delete. Разбиение потока данных осуществляется на основе обязательного столбца __$operation и его стандартных значений в таблице изменений SQL Server 2012.
Значение операции |
Вывод |
Описание |
---|---|---|
1 |
Удаление |
Удаленная строка |
2 |
Вставка |
Вставленная строка (недоступно при использовании режима CDC Суммарные со слиянием) |
3 |
Обновление |
Строка перед обновлением (доступно только при использовании режима CDC Все со старыми значениями) |
4 |
Обновление |
Строка после обновления (следует за строкой, которая имела место перед обновлением) |
5 |
Обновление |
Строка слияния (доступно только при использовании режима CDC Суммарные со слиянием) |
Другое |
Ошибка |
Разделитель вы можете использовать для подключения к стандартным выводам INSERT, DELETE и UPDATE в целях дальнейшей обработки.
Преобразование «Разделитель CDC» имеет один обычный ввод и один вывод ошибок.
Обработка ошибок
Преобразование «Разделитель CDC» имеет вывод ошибок. Входные строки с недопустимым значением в столбце $operation рассматриваются как ошибочные и обрабатываются в соответствии со свойством ввода ErrorRowDisposition.
Вывод ошибок компонента включает следующие выходные столбцы:
Код ошибки: Задан равным 1.
Столбец с ошибкой: Входной столбец, вызывающий ошибку (это относится к ошибкам преобразования).
Столбцы строки с ошибкой: Входные столбцы строки, которая вызвала ошибку.
Настройка разделителя CDC
Какие-либо настраиваемые свойства для разделителя CDC отсутствуют.
Дополнительные сведения об использовании разделителя CDC см. в разделе «Компоненты CDC для служб Microsoft SQL Server Integration Services».
Диалоговое окно Расширенный редактор содержит свойства, которые могут быть заданы программным путем.
Открытие диалогового окна Расширенный редактор:
- На экране Поток данных вашего проекта Службы SQL Server 2012 Integration Services (SSIS) щелкните правой кнопкой мыши разделитель CDC и выберите элемент Показать расширенный редактор.
См. также
Задания
Выбор направления потока CDC в соответствии с типом изменения